About This Program
The Computer and Information Systems Security/Auditing/Information Assurance certificate program at Fox Valley Technical College is a two- to four-year credential offered by this public institution in Appleton, WI. The program covers cybersecurity principles, network security, risk assessment, auditing practices, and information assurance strategies used to protect organizational data and systems.
This program is part of the computer and information systems security field (CIP 11.1003) and is one of the information technology certificates at Fox Valley Technical College.
